Major changes:
- Remove old snippet rendering code and use the new stuff.
- Introduce `span_label` method to add a label
- Remove EndSpan mode and replace with a fn to get the last
character of a span.
- Stop using `Option<MultiSpan>` and just use an empty `MultiSpan`
- and probably a bunch of other stuff :)
MultiSpan model is now:
- set of primary spans
- set of span+label pairs
Primary spans render with `^^^`, secondary spans with `---`.
Labels are placed next to the `^^^` or `---` marker as appropriate.
This uncovered a lot of bugs in compiletest and also some shortcomings
of our existing JSON output. We had to add information to the JSON
output, such as suggested text and macro backtraces. We also had to fix
various bugs in the existing tests.
Joint work with jntrnr.

The protocol for `serialize::{En,De}code` doesn't allow for two
integers to be serialized next to each other. This switches the
protocol to serializing `Span`s as a struct. rbml structs don't
have any overhead, so the metadata shouldn't increase in size,
but it allows the json format to be properly generated, albeit
slightly more heavy than when it was just serializing a span as
a u64.
Closes#31025.

Make `span_to_lines` to return a `Result`.
(This is better than just asserting internally, since it allows caller
to decide if they can recover from the problem.)
Added type alias for `FileLinesResult` returned by `span_to_lines`.
Update embedded unit test to reflect `span_to_lines` signature change.
In diagnostic, catch `Err` from `span_to_lines` and print
`"(internal compiler error: unprintable span)"` instead.
----
There a number of recent issues that report the bug here. See
e.g. #24761 and #24954.
This change *might* fix them. However, that is not its main goal.
The main goals are:
1. Make it possible for callers to recover from an error here, and
2. Insert a more conservative check, in that we are
also checking that the files match up.
Changes the style guidelines regarding unit tests to recommend using a
sub-module named "tests" instead of "test" for unit tests as "test"
might clash with imports of libtest.
This commit removes all the old casting/generic traits from `std::num` that are
no longer in use by the standard library. This additionally removes the old
`strconv` module which has not seen much use in quite a long time. All generic
functionality has been supplanted with traits in the `num` crate and the
`strconv` module is supplanted with the [rust-strconv crate][rust-strconv].
[rust-strconv]: https://github.com/lifthrasiir/rust-strconv
This is a breaking change due to the removal of these deprecated crates, and the
alternative crates are listed above.
[breaking-change]
